2. Adomukhi Svanasana:

Adomukhi Svanasana is also known as a downward-facing dog pose. 

Steps for Adomukhi Svanasana: 

·         Keep your palms under the shoulder and knees below your hips. 

·         Then you need to lift your hips and form an inverted ‘V’ with the help of your body. 

·         Then, you need to place your hands shoulder width apart and your fingers should be pointed. 

·         Then, you need to open your shoulder blades after putting pressure on your palms. 

·         Try to push your heels towards the floor. 

3. Halasana:

Halasana is also known as plough pose. 

Steps for Halasana:

·         First, you need to lie down on your backside on a yoga mat. 

·         Then, keep your palms on the floor beside your body, facing towards your feet. 

·     Then, with the help of your abdominal muscles, you need to lift your legs in a 90-degree position. 

·     Then, by pressing your palms gently on the ground and trying to fall your legs behind your head without bending your legs. 

·     You need to lift your middle and lower back area to be able to touch your toes on the ground, behind your head. 

·         Try to bring your chest close to the chin area. 

·         You can use your palm to support your back. 

4. Padahastasana:

Padahastasana is also known as hands under foot pose and gorilla pose. 

Steps for Padahastasana:

·         First, you need to stand in samasthiti. 

·         Then you need to exhale while you bend your upper body from the hips towards the feet to be able to touch your nose to your knees. 

·         Keep your palms on either side of your feet.
